Den ideella verksamheten och dess betydelse för individen The voluntary organisations meaning for the individual

In Sweden the voluntary socialwork is a complement to the public authorities. The voluntary organisations has become more important considered helping people in different situations of need. The aim of this study has been to examine the voluntary organisations meaning for individuals. The aim was reached through interviews by five guests from different organisations. We have also interviewed two employees from the different organisations to find out if there is any differences in their way of work. This study indicates that the organisations means a lot for the individuals. The social network, something to do during the day, a kind treatment but also the milieu are factors that seems important for the individuals. The organisations even creates a feeling of connection and satisfy other kind of needs. .

För vem redovisar i första hand hjälporganisationer?

The purpose of this essay was to identify the primary stakeholder in aid organisations, by which we mean whom they make their annual report for, and to analyse if there were any differences considering the design of their annual reports depending on which their primary stakeholder is. The method we used to explain the choice of primary stakeholder and the differences in the annual reports was a multiple case study. The collected data came from telephone interviews with 23 representatives from aid organisations and a review of annual reports. The results were analysed through pattern matching. We found that aid organisations do not have a primary stakeholder as in incorporated organisations.

Brukarorganisationers syn på ICF som arbetsredskap ? och dess betydelse för erkännande och omfördelning

This study was about disability organisations opinion concerning ICF: s importance in their work to receive the same recognition and human rights for their members as citizens. The aim has been to elucidate disability organisations awareness about and use/non use of ICF and to increase the understanding of ICF: s importance for recognition and redistribution. Three different methods have been used: literature study, questionnaire survey, both on counties' (27) - and national (26) level and interviews (5) on national level. There is also a distinct difference between the disability organisations that represents people with visible impairments, who don?t think that ICF is so useful and they that represent people with invisible impairments, who thinks that ICF is a useful tool.
